Description

In Greater Manchester there are an estimated 120,000 people experiencing Multiple Disadvantage. This is defined as a combination of homelessness, substance misuse, mental health issues, domestic abuse and contact with the criminal justice system. Since 2021 GMCA have been working with localities to deliver a specific support programme for people experiencing multiple disadvantage, which doesn't work in silos. In order to facilitate learning and development of this programme, the GMCA have commissioned a consultant to support areas to develop their local program. In order to facilitate learning and development of this programme, the provider will be delivering 50 days of support. This support will include a mixture of support, mostly as 1:1 for individual areas (through a named lead) and with a small amount of group support. The provider will be guided by areas' ambitions and support needs based on their local priorities for work, it may take the form of advice/informal coaching, supporting with evidence gathering or policy synthesis, facilitating workshops or similar. The group support will involve areas coming together once at the beginning and once at the end of the support to share learning experiences with each other in a structured way.
